RFP-26-22943: Concourse A Fire Protection System Expansion, IAD NEW
Description: The Airports Authority is seeking to acquire a design-build contractor to design and construct an expansion to the fire protection system at the Regional A Gates Boarding Areas (Gates A1A–A6E) at Washington Dulles International Airport (IAD).
Solicitation Issue Date: July 23, 2026
Due Date for Submissions: August 24, 2026
Amendments Issued: None
SLBE Requirement: None
